Latest Patents

Kenney's recent patents delve into advanced methods of forming stacked semiconductor devices. One notable innovation is the method of forming devices that incorporate subsurface structures within or adjacent to horizontal trenches in bulk single crystal semiconductors. His designs include three-terminal devices, such as Field-Effect Transistors (FETs) and bipolar transistors, as well as rectifying contacts including pn diodes and Schottky diodes. The stackable configuration facilitates low resistance connectors and minimizes overlap capacitance, improving overall device performance. Additionally, Kenney presented a process for creating a subsurface CMOS inverter and a method for fabricating complementary transistors through sequential implantations, allowing for a more streamlined production process of planar CMOS structures.
